Which Career Pays More?

Social and Community Service Managers professionals earn $35,410 more per year than Customer Service Representatives professionals — that's 82.7% higher. At the 90th percentile, Customer Service Representatives earns $62,730 compared to $129,820 for Social and Community Service Managers.

Detailed Salary Comparison

PercentileCustomer Service RepresentativesSocial and Community Service ManagersDifference
10th Percentile$30,690$50,020$-19,330
25th Percentile$35,970$62,420$-26,450
Median (50th)$42,830$78,240$-35,410
75th Percentile$50,140$100,600$-50,460
90th Percentile$62,730$129,820$-67,090
Mean (Average)$45,380$86,100$-40,720
